Multiculturalists

Multiculturalists are advocates or supporters of the concept of multiculturalism, which recognizes the diverse cultural backgrounds and identities within a society. They promote the idea that cultural differences should be celebrated and respected, and they often aim to create an inclusive environment where various ethnic and cultural groups can coexist harmoniously.
